美国司法部于周二起诉丹佛市,指控该市实施数十年的半自动武器禁令违反第二修正案。
这项颁布于近40年前的丹佛市条例限制使用容弹量超过15发的弹匣的枪支,包括任何经过改装后达到该标准的武器。周二提起的民事诉讼请求法官下令禁止该市及其警方执行这项武器禁令,并要求相关部门出台政策“纠正”侵犯民众权利的行为。
“守法的美国民众,无论居住在哪个城市或州,都不应仅仅因为行使第二修正案赋予的拥有武器的权利,就面临刑事处罚的威胁,而这类武器是数千万同胞都合法持有的。”司法部民权司司长哈米特·迪隆在一份声明中说道。
美国司法部已发誓要起诉全美各地违反其认定的宪法标准的枪支政策相关州政府和地方政府。司法部去年专门设立了第二修正案部门,负责牵头提起此类诉讼。
该司法部门此前已提起多起诉讼,其中包括针对华盛顿特区对AR-15式武器的限制措施的诉讼,还起诉了美属维尔京群岛警察局,指控其存在不合理的持枪许可审批拖延问题。
AR-15是美国广受欢迎的步枪型号之一。
迪隆早在4月底就曾向丹佛市发出潜在诉讼警告,称如果市政府官员同意停止执行禁令并承认该条例违宪,就可以避免诉讼程序。
市领导层拒绝了这一建议,称该条例在一定程度上推动了暴力犯罪率下降,并指出全美各地的法院此前已驳回过类似案件。
“你的要求毫无根据、不负责任,明显是对联邦政府权力的越界使用。”市检察官米科·布朗在周一的回信中说道,他还补充道,“废除一项已生效37年的常识性禁令,将攻击性武器重新带回我市社区,绝非解决之道。”

The Justice Department sued Denver on Tuesday, alleging that the city’s decades-old ban on semi-automatic weapons violates the Second Amendment.
Enacted nearly 40 years ago, the Denver ordinance restricts firearms with magazines over 15 rounds, including any weapons that have been modified to do so. The civil lawsuit filed Tuesday asks a judge to stop the city and its police department from enforcing the weapons ban and to implement policies that “correct” instances in which people’s rights were violated.
“Law-abiding Americans, regardless of what city or state they reside in, should not have to live under threat of criminal sanction just for exercising their Second Amendment right to possess arms which are owned by tens of millions of their fellow citizens,” Harmeet Dhillon, the head of the department’s Civil Rights Division, said in a statement.
The Justice Department has vowed to sue state and local governments across the country for gun policies it claims violate the Constitution. The DOJ established a Second Amendment Section last year to lead the charge in filing those cases.
The Justice Department division has filed other lawsuits, including one against Washington, DC, for its restrictions on AR-15-style weapons. The department has also sued the Virgin Islands Police Department for permitting delays it says are unreasonable.
The AR-15 is among the popular rifles owned in the US.
Dhillon first warned the city of a potential lawsuit in late April, writing that Denver could avoid the process if officials agreed to stop enforcing the ban and acknowledge it was unconstitutional.
City leaders rejected the notion, crediting the ordinance in part for a drop in violent crime and noting that courts across the country have previously rejected similar cases.
“Your request is baseless, irresponsible, and a clear overreach of the federal government’s power,” City Attorney Miko Brown said in a response letter dated Monday, adding that “reversing a common-sense ban that has worked for 37 years and bringing assault weapons back into the City’s neighborhoods is not one of them.”
